The Underlying Issue: AI's Dependency on Infrastructure
The ChatGPT failure highlighted a key difficulty in the AI landscape: the heavy dependence on cloud-based facilities. A lot of AI tools, including ChatGPT, are hosted on cloud servers, which go through technical failures, server overloads, or maintenance problems. When the infrastructure supporting these systems goes down, the AI tool ends up being inaccessible.
This raises questions about the strength and redundancy of the infrastructure powering AI tools. While many cloud provider have sophisticated systems in location to prevent blackouts, the scale of an AI tool like ChatGPT suggests that even a short disruption can have significant effects.
The Wake-Up Call: How Can AI Reliability Be Improved?
The ChatGPT international blackout works as an essential suggestion that AI tools, in spite of their extraordinary abilities, are still vulnerable to technical failures. To resolve these concerns and ensure AI reliability in the future, a number of strategies can be implemented:
1. Enhancing Redundancy in Infrastructure
One of the most effective ways to avoid future blackouts is to boost redundancy within the infrastructure. This means having backup systems in location to deal with failures, whether it's using numerous data centers, diversifying cloud suppliers, or executing failover systems. Redundancy makes sure that if one part of the system stops working, another can take over, lessening the effect on users.
2. Building More Resilient AI Models
AI designs require to be developed with strength in mind. When it comes to ChatGPT, for example, OpenAI might explore methods to ensure that, even in the occasion of a blackout, the system can continue to function at a minimized capacity or instantly recover once the issue is dealt with. Producing systems that can manage disturbances without compromising service quality is critical for ensuring dependability.
3. Proactive Communication with Users
When a blackout does occur, prompt and clear interaction is essential. Users must be informed about the issue, its anticipated period, and any actions being required to fix it. OpenAI, for instance, could have provided real-time updates on social media platforms or through their website to keep users informed, which would have helped in reducing frustration and confusion during the ChatGPT outage.
4. Regular Maintenance and Testing
AI systems need regular maintenance to guarantee that they continue to operate correctly. This consists of evaluating the system's performance, fixing bugs, upgrading security procedures, and attending to any technical problems. By carrying out these maintenance tasks proactively, companies can reduce the opportunities of unanticipated failures and improve the total dependability of their AI systems.
5. Exploring Decentralized AI Models
While cloud-based AI systems have actually ended up being the standard, decentralized AI models could offer a potential option to the dependence on a single point of failure. Decentralized designs spread the computing load across several nodes or devices, minimizing the impact of a failure in any one place. This method might make AI tools more resilient and less susceptible to interruptions brought on by infrastructure failures.
